- The USTA says the two-day event drew 78,000 to the grounds with Arthur Ashe sold out and more than 20,000 fans in Louis Armstrong on Tuesday.
- Coverage expanded globally, with 17 networks in over 170 territories and 13 hours of ESPN broadcasts carrying every match.
- US Open digital channels spiked to 2.2 million app and web visits, and YouTube logged 12.8 million organic views for a one-day record.
- Defending champions Sara Errani and Andrea Vavassori retained the title and collected a $1 million winners’ purse.
- The condensed format and invite-heavy field drew criticism from doubles specialists including Jamie Murray, while Emma Raducanu urged other majors to try similar showcases and reports noted withdrawals by Aryna Sabalenka and Jannik Sinner.
